The US plans to reopen a consulate in Greenland to strengthen its presence and protect interests in the region. This move follows historical precedents, as a consulate was previously established in 1940 but closed 13 years later. Recently, President Trump expressed interest in purchasing Greenland, citing its resources and strategic location. Despite criticism, the State Department intends to open the consulate next year with a staff of seven.
